Trifluoromethanesulfonamide
Molecular Formula: CH₂F₃NO₂S
CAS No.: 421-85-2
Trifluoromethanesulfonamide contains both a trifluoromethyl group (–CF₃) and a sulfonamide group (–SO₂NH–) in its molecular structure, which gives it unique chemical properties. Due to the strong electron-withdrawing effect of the trifluoromethanesulfonyl group, the amino group shows lower basicity and nucleophilicity compared with free alkyl amines. It can undergo condensation reactions with acyl chlorides and carboxylic acids, and can also be alkylated with methyl iodide.
Practical Applications
The main applications of Trifluoromethanesulfonamide are focused on organic synthesis intermediates and battery electrolyte additives, as detailed below:
1. Pharmaceutical & Fine Chemical Synthesis
It is used as a key intermediate for the synthesis of phospholipase A₂ (PLA₂) selective inhibitors, which are important in the development of drugs for inflammatory and metabolic diseases. It is also involved in the synthesis of eicosanoid-related and other bioactive molecules, supporting the development of high-potency and high-selectivity pharmaceuticals.
2. New Energy Battery Materials
When combined with ionic liquids, it is used to formulate high-voltage, high-stability electrolytes, improving power density and cycling durability.
As an electrolyte additive for lithium-ion and other secondary batteries, it can significantly enhance electrolyte performance, improving cycle stability, charge–discharge efficiency, and safety, and thereby extending battery life.
3. Other Organic Synthesis Applications
Thanks to its unique chemical properties, it is widely used in the synthesis of fluorinated organic compounds, including:
-
High-efficiency herbicides and fungicides
-
High-purity cleaning agents and photoresist additives for semiconductor manufacturing
-
Modification monomers for polyimides and fluoropolymers
-
Low-viscosity, high-conductivity ionic liquids
